UPGRADING OF NAMICHIGA–RUANGWA ROAD SECTION (20.60KM) TO BITUMEN STANDARD,
TENDER NO. AE/001/2026-2027/HQ/W/17 (TZ-TANROADS-564150-CW-RFB)
- This Invitation for Bids follows the General Procurement Notice for this Project that appeared in the United Nations Development Business (UNDB) No. WB-P890351-12/21 of 14th December 2021.
- The Government of the United Republic of Tanzania has received financing from the World Bank toward the cost of the Roads to Inclusion and Socio-Economic Opportunities Project (RISE) and intends to apply part of the proceeds toward payments under the contract for Upgrading of Namichiga–Ruangwa Road Section (20.60Km) to Bitumen Standard., Tender No. AE/001/2026-2027/HQ/W/36 (TZ-TANROADS-564150-CW-RFB).
- The Tanzania National Roads Agency (TANROADS) now invites sealed Bids from eligible Bidders for Upgrading Namichiga–Ruangwa Road Section (20.60Km) to Bitumen Standard for the construction period of 18 months inclusive of three (3) months mobilization from the commencement date and 12 months Defects Notification Period.
- Margin of preference is not applicable.
- The Works consist of upgrading of the existing gravel surfaced road to Bitumen Standard, re-working the existing 20.6 km double surfaces dressing to Double Bituminous Surface Dressing (DBSD), construction of embankment, drainage structures involving box culverts, pipe culverts as well as pavement layers and ancillary works as stipulated in the Bills of Quantities. The estimated major quantities of works are as follows: -
S/N | DESCRIPTION | UNITS | QUANTITIES |
1 | Clearing and Grubbing | Ha | 34 |
2 | Common Excavation including Cut to Spoil | m3 | 320,037 |
3 | Rock Excavation | m3 | 9,601 |
4 | Common Fill G3 | m3 | 143,519 |
5 | Improved Subgrade Natural Gravel (G7) | m3 | 82,867 |
6 | Improved Subgrade Natural Gravel (G15) | m3 | 39,811 |
7 | Cement Stabilized Subbase, C1 | m3 | 47,662 |
8 | Crushed aggregates class CRR | m3 | 31,881 |
9 | Prime coat, MC-30 Cutback Bitumen | Lt. | 404,486 |
10 | Double Surface dressing | m2 | 202,243 |
11 | Concrete Pipe Culverts all Sizes | m | 365 |
12 | Concrete all Classes | m3 | 3,742 |
13 | Reinforcement Steel | T | 440 |
